In-Person Worship: Target Date

Posted by Union Chapel Communications Team on

While we deeply desire to return to in-person worship and activities at Union Chapel Indy, we want to do it safely. As leadership decides when we can safely return to such events, we will consider all government guidelines and mandates, data from trusted resources, denominational guidelines, and suggestions, as well as our own capacity to manage such an endeavor safely.
 
Given the current rise in COVID-19 cases in the state of Indiana, and the age of many of Union Chapel congregants, and the ongoing construction inconveniences at the church at this time, we (Pastor Elizabeth in consultation with Staff and Unified Council Members) have postponed in-person worship until at least September 1. Please stay tuned to Union Chapel messages for updates or changes to this timeline.
 
In the meantime, staff is working on a detailed plan to ready the building and Union Chapel's processes so that when the date arrives that we feel we can safely return, all will be ready. This includes facility safety, cleanliness, and signage, as well as appropriate training for staff and volunteers.
